It’s a specialist plant propagation business committed to producing best-in-class plants, focusing on soft fruit, shrubs, and trees. As one of the UK’s top 10 growing sites, it operates a 30-hectare outdoor propagation area, particularly strong in strawberry, raspberry, and blackberry plants. Established in 2021 as the propagation arm of Clock House Farm, Linton Growing initially aimed to reduce reliance on overseas plant suppliers and ensure quality control. While still supplying Clock House Farm, it’s now an independent business building relationships with other growers. Sourcing plants from Linton Growing offers a route to quality fruit with superior genetics, delivering superb results in flavour, size, and shelf life.

Financially, Linton Growing Ltd presents a mixed picture. Current assets dropped by 20% to £1.5 million, while net assets increased by 36% to £1.2 million. Bank borrowings decreased significantly by 63%, falling to £510,000, and cash reserves remain relatively stable. Creditors decreased by 40%, suggesting better debt management. The company meets the criteria for a small company, with fewer than 50 employees and assets under £5.1 million. The company’s unaudited financial statements, prepared by Chavereys Limited, show a significant increase in corporation tax payable, rising 160% to £180,000. Despite this, the company appears to be holding its own, though the increased tax liability warrants further investigation.
